Control: reassign -1 udev 238-4 Am 09.05.2018 um 12:24 schrieb René Krell: > When pressing it, the following lines are added to the /var/log/message > s file: > May 8 22:22:50 rkrell kernel: [40955.295433] atkbd serio0: Unknown key > pressed (translated set 2, code 0xf8 on isa0060/serio0). > May 8 22:22:50 rkrell kernel: [40955.295440] atkbd serio0: Use > 'setkeycodes e078 <keycode>' to make it known. > May 8 22:22:50 rkrell kernel: [40955.469669] atkbd serio0: Unknown key > released (translated set 2, code 0xf8 on isa0060/serio0). > May 8 22:22:50 rkrell kernel: [40955.469675] atkbd serio0: Use > 'setkeycodes e078 <keycode>' to make it known. > > I'd expect the WLAN hardware button to respond immediately on pressing > it to toggle WLAN on/off.
It looks like you want to map that keycode to "wlan". Typically this is done via a hwdb entry, Have a look at /lib/udev/hwdb.d/60-keyboard.hwdb for this. See https://wiki.archlinux.org/index.php/Map_scancodes_to_keycodes how you can create such a custom hwdb entry for your hardware.
